In the heart of one of Europe’s most iconic cities, a groundbreaking blockchain event is set to take center stage—Hacking Paris, Chiliz’s flagship hackathon designed to fuse innovation, sports, and decentralized technology.
Scheduled for July 11–13, 2025, at the legendary Parc des Princes stadium, Hacking Paris invites developers, creators, and blockchain enthusiasts from around the world to build the next generation of fan engagement tools using the Chiliz Chain. With a $150,000 prize pool and access to global sports brands, the event promises not just a hackathon—but a full-scale celebration of what’s possible when Web3 meets the passion of sport.

Key Themes and Tracks in the Hackathon
Participants will compete across five focused tracks, each tackling real-world challenges in the sports and blockchain space:
- Fan Token Utility – $50,000
Build tools or experiences that expand the utility of fan tokens and deepen fan engagement. - Digital Merchandise & NFTs – $22,000
Create NFT-based digital assets and collectibles to drive fandom and value. - Stadium Experience Enhancement – $22,000
Improve in-stadium experiences using Web3 or IoT, from gamification to exclusive access. - Decentralized Governance & Voting – $22,000
Develop systems that give fans a voice in club decisions through on-chain governance. - Fan Monetization & Content Creation – $24,000
Empower fans to create, monetize, and distribute their own sports content.
